  • Santa Barbara County Uses CalRecycle Grant Funds to Rebuild Roadway with Recycled Tires

    In March 2018, CalRecycle awarded Santa Barbara county $158,241 in Tire-Derived Aggregate Grant Program funds to create a new retaining wall. Full story…

  • CalRecycle Releases Draft EIR for SB 1383 Regulations

    CalRecycle has released its Draft Program Environmental Impact Report for the statewide adoption of regulations for Short-Lived Climate Pollutants: Organic Waste Methane Emission Reduction (SB 1383, Lara, Chapter 395, Statutes of 2016).
